Call For Papers

The National Association of African American Studies and Affiliates will co-host an international research forum with Nelson Mandela Metropolitan University. The research forum will be held in Port Elizabeth, South Africa, July 20-22, 2011.

Persons interested in presenting a paper should select a topic related to improvement of education/educational practices for African children. Topics may include, but are not limited to: role of government, testing, social issues, school development, role of parents, etc.

Abstracts, not to exceed two (2) pages, must be submitted by October 30, 2010. The forum will be limited to fifty (50) presenters.
